Output 8495662852abe4883dd43ac8210ef1fbf4350e63a39fcfeec1d3b570e7c8e4ce:16

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06b49f6325ac57c81520e262e1291d33684c4c76 OP_EQUAL
address
32JUMaDNDmQTiuTr8PwZdwfTfUbuTWzWcz
transaction
8495662852abe4883dd43ac8210ef1fbf4350e63a39fcfeec1d3b570e7c8e4ce
spent
true